On the court's own motion, it is
ORDERED that its decision and order on motion dated December 12, 2006, in the above-entitled matter is recalled and vacated, and the following decision and order on motion is substituted therefor:
Motion by the appellant for leave to prosecute appeals from three orders of the Supreme Court, Westchester County (IDV Part), dated April 6, 2006, April 25, 2006, and May 8, 2006, respectively, as a poor person and for the assignment of counsel, and to enlarge his time to perfect the appeals.
Upon the papers filed in support of the motion and the papers filed in opposition thereto, it is
ORDERED that the branch of the motion which is for leave to prosecute the appeal as a poor person and for the assignment of counsel is denied; and it is further,
ORDERED that the branch of the motion which is to enlarge time is granted, the appellant's time to perfect the appeal by causing the original papers constituting the record on the appeal to be filed in the office of the Clerk of this court (see 22 NYCRR 670.9[d][2]), and by serving and filing his brief on the appeal is enlarged until January 12, 2007; and it is further,
ORDERED that no further enlargements of time shall be granted.
